We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Principal Security Architect, who will be responsible for ensuring that all enterprise platforms and solutions align with our existing security framework and industry standards. This role requires a deep understanding of security principles, technologies and best practices to protect our information assets and ensure compliance with regulatory requirements. The focus will be on collaborating with key stakeholders across various domains to enable our technology colleagues to work efficiently and manage their environments effectively. You will perform comprehensive risk assessments, develop strategies to mitigate threats, and ensure alignment with organisational security principles and best practices.
You will be responsible for
Design and implement robust security architectures for enterprise-wide capabilities that our technology teams rely on regularly to operate their services and perform day‑to‑day tasks efficiently, addressing identified threats and vulnerabilities.
Conduct thorough risk assessments for new systems and existing environments, reviewing their designs and architectures to ensure they meet modern security requirements; identify security risks and recommend mitigation strategies.
Influence and guide other teams to implement security solutions by collaborating across functions to integrate security principles and ensure systems align with business needs.
Ensure all enterprise platforms align with our existing security framework and industry standards, collaborating with other enabling and architecture teams to integrate security into all aspects of the organisation’s operations.
Evaluate and enhance security processes to improve their efficiency and comprehensiveness.
Continuously monitor and respond to emerging security trends and threats to workplace environments, virtualisation technologies and databases.
Develop and maintain security architecture documentation, including policies, diagrams and procedural guides.
Act as an SME and advise on the security of the cloud, workplace and infrastructure control plane capabilities such as virtualisation layers.
Lead and participate in internal technology initiatives to implement secure enterprise systems, ensuring alignment with security frameworks and organisational goals to enhance security posture.
You will need Soft Skills:
Proven leadership experience as a technical individual contributor in complex organisations.
Analytical mindset with a proactive approach to identifying and solving security challenges.
Strong communication and interpersonal skills to articulate complex security concepts to diverse audiences.
Ability to work collaboratively with cross‑functional teams while managing multiple initiatives.
Demonstrated curiosity and flexibility in applying knowledge and advice.
Technical Skills:
Demonstrable experience and expertise in designing, implementing and applying balanced controls from security frameworks such as NIST, CIS, ISO 27001 and MITRE.
Expertise in security controls and best practices for cloud‑based workplace environments.
Proficiency in Microsoft cloud security, compliance capabilities, identity and access management, and threat protection, including Microsoft Defender, Microsoft Entra and Microsoft Purview.
Expertise with on‑prem virtualisation and container platforms.
Familiarity with virtualisation security best practices and endpoint security.
Proficiency in securing databases (e.g. SQL, NoSQL).
Proficiency in risk analysis, security controls management planning and disaster recovery planning.
Experience with security technologies such as firewalls, intrusion detection/prevention systems and encryption.
Qualifications & Experience
Strong knowledge of security frameworks and standards (e.g. NIST, ISO 27001).
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ology or equivalent experience.
Minimum of 5 years in a security architecture role.
Professional certifications such as SABSA, CISSP, CISM or TOGAF are highly desirable.
